UPVC Door window locks repair near me Replacement
UPVC locks on windows and doors could be easily damaged. This could be because of severe weather conditions or regular use. If you have a broken lock, it's important to call a locksmith as soon as possible.
Multipoint door locks are among the most secure options for your home or business. If they're not working properly, it could be a costly repair.
Cost
There are many reasons for individuals to replace the locks on their doors, including to increase security or meet the requirements of insurance. There are also those who need to replace their locks after an incident of burglary or loss of keys. A professional locksmith will be able to provide a same-day lock installation service in most instances. A professional locksmith can also assist with other tasks like fixing broken windows and boarding up doors that have been damaged.
The costs of replacing a Upvc lock are usually affordable and can be done quickly. Most locksmiths charge between PS35 and PS50 to replace an ordinary cylinder lock. However should the lock need to be rekeyed or a new key is required, these charges will rise. A skilled locksmith will complete the job quickly and to a top standard, and will ensure that their work is completed on time and to your satisfaction.
If your upvc window lock replacement door is difficult to open, it may be due to an unlubricated lock mechanism or internal hinges. If this is the case, you should try to lubricate them to see if this solves the problem. If this doesn't resolve the issue, you should call a professional locksmith to fix it.
A floppy handle mechanism is a common issue with upvc window replacement lock doors. It is fixable by tightening the screw that holds the door handle in place. You will be able to locate the screw in the barrel of the handle and tighten it with the help of a screwdriver. The handle of the door should be tightened and the door should lock correctly.
A damaged cylinder is the most frequent reason for the uPVC lock to be difficult to lock. The cylinder can be repaired by a professional locksmith and the door will become secure again. The good news is that the cylindrical part is an universal component of the lock and is available at the majority of hardware stores.
It is worth investing in an anti-snap euro cylinder if you have multipoint locking systems on your uPVC door. They're a great alternative to standard cylinders because they're tested to resist the most popular method of lock picking that is known as "lock snapping".
Security
It is possible to enhance the security of your home by replacing the lock made of upvc. It's a cost-effective alternative that can deter burglars. It is not a replacement for installing a multipoint lock or to board up windows that are broken. A professional locksmith will make sure that the job is completed to the highest standard and that the locks have been fitted properly.
If your uPVC locks aren't locking properly the hinge or barrel may be misaligned. It is usually possible to solve this yourself by using a screwdriver to remove the screws or screws that hold the handle and barrel in the correct position. You can also use a tape measure to determine the proper measurements for the cylinder of your lock. This is essential to ensure that the new lock is fitted correctly and will not protrude more than millimetres.
You can choose between a number of different locks based on the type of door you have. Euro Cylinder locks are the most common. These are a good choice since they provide a higher level of security than other types of cylinder locks. But, it's important to make sure that the cylinder you choose is of a high-quality and has been tested to the latest British Kite Mark standards.
There are a variety of ways burglars can gain entry into homes, including manipulation of locks and brute force. UPVC doors provide easy access to thieves. You can reduce the risk of your upvc window lock repairs near me door being smashed by converting it to an anti-snap cylinder.
A uPVC door lock is made of two components: the central case and the lock cylinder. The central case regulates the rest of the lock. The lock cylinder in uPVC can fail. When this occurs, it can be difficult to open the door. A professional locksmith will replace the damaged part to ensure that the lock is operating in the way it should. They can also install a new anti-snap euro Cylinder.
Durability
Upvc door locks can last for a long time. They also require very little maintenance. To keep them working correctly, they require to be cleaned and lubricated on a regular basis. It is important to note, however, that the installation of these locks is crucial to their efficiency. It is recommended to have them installed by a professional locksmith, to ensure the locks are properly installed and reduce security vulnerabilities.
One of the most common problems that is encountered with uPVC door locks is that they get jammed. This could be due to a variety of circumstances, including weather conditions that cause the lock's alignment to become misaligned. You might also have to replace a loose handle mechanism or a damaged gearbox. To repair a uPVC lock that is jammed, first find the barrel and the screws or screw caps that hold it in place. Use a screwdriver and undo the screws or screw caps. After you have removed the screw, it should open up the hole in the frame.
If needed, you can unscrew the bolt. Then, you'll need to take off the lock cylinder and then measure it to determine the size for replacement. There are a variety of uPVC locks that are available, but the two most commonly used are anti-snap Euro cylinder locks and euro cylinders. If you're looking to replace the cylinder of your lock, be sure to choose a model that has a British Kite Mark. It is more secure than a standard cylinder lock, and also harder to pick.
Change your locks is recommended for a variety of reasons, from improving home security to meeting insurance requirements. While it can be expensive to hire a locksmith it's worth the money to get peace of mind that your home is safe from intruders. It's also a good idea to consider adding additional security features like strengthening the door frame and upgrading the lock's cylinders. A professional locksmith can recommend the best options based on your security requirements. Consider keyed-alike options if you have more than one uPVC door on your property. This will make it easier to streamline access without the security.

You'll first have to take out your old cylinder lock. To do this, you'll need to unlock the front door to gain access to the interior edge of the door, as well as the side of faceplate of the lock. Once you've gained access to the entire lock, you can unscrew the screw that secures the inside faceplate. Then, you'll need to tighten the exterior faceplate at the top and bottom.
You'll need to determine the size. You can measure the size of the lock with a tape or by removing it from your door. You'll want to measure the cylinder's diameter from the center hole to both edges. You'll need to determine the distance from the cam of the cylinder to the square spindle that connects the door handle to the handle.
Once you've measured the cylinder, you'll need to buy a new cylinder lock of the same size. They can be found online or in an area hardware store. You must ensure that the new cylinder is made of high-quality material and has a British Kite mark.
